Speaking of ‘Lies’ this is certainly not ‘special to The Jewish Times.’ It appeared in Jerusalem Post some time ago. Has the Jewish Times contacted the Rabbi of Madrid for his response ? The issue that Rabbi Sacks avoids is that the Orthodox don’t accept Conservative conversions and therefore asked that the boy be immersed in the mikveh a second time in the presence of two Kosher witnesses, i.e. two adult Jewish male witnesses who accept the basic principle of ‘Torah min HaShomayin’ or the revealed nature of Torah, a principle not necessarily accepted by Conservatives.
